**Action item (P2):** The Copperline driver-assignment heuristic kept favoring idle drivers two zones away, which is what blew up dispatch times during the Harrowgate incident. We're adding a distance penalty and a shadow-mode comparison before rollout. New folks, skim the heuristic design notes first — they're on the page below.

operations page: https://confluence.tolvaqsys.corp/spaces/pages/pages/6e787158f507

Subject: Kiosk cut-over wrap-up

Hey all — the Brightgate kiosk cut-over finished Tuesday night with zero rollbacks. The new watchdog in OrbitShell now restarts the lobby app instead of rebooting the whole unit, which cut recovery time way down. Marnie verified all twelve kiosks at the Felwick depot. For reference at the sync, here are the watchdog's current configuration values:

service settings:
[casax]
port = 6379
team = rusir
host = casax.zemvarhq.corp
region = outer-4
access_code = ac_9808ce
timeout_ms = 1500

Sort order in the Tallyforge report builder is stable: rows with equal sort keys retain insertion order from the upstream query. Do not rely on this for grouped exports — the Parqette exporter re-partitions and voids the guarantee. Tiebreak explicitly with row_id when determinism matters. Integration tests hit the internal sort-verification endpoint, which authenticates with the service key below.

gateway credential: kto3_qfe